Get this. There are only three ingredients…
- Semi-Sweet Baking Chocolate 8oz.
- Whole Package of Oreos
- 2} 8oz. Packages of Cream Cheese

Basically you simply use a food processor to grind up the Oreos then mix into the softened cream cheese (use your hands). Then form small balls (or hearts?) and dip in melted chocolate. (We melted the chocolate on medium low on the stove.) Let them cool for a few hours in the fridge and… (uh huh, we didn’t make it that long either!)
